The Battle of Midway was a decisive naval battle in the Pacific Theater of World War II which occurred between the 4th and the 7th of June 1942, only six months after Japan's attack on Pearl Harbor.

President Franklin Delano Roosevelt passes away after four momentous terms in office. 1:00 PM Roosevelt complained about a terrible pain in the back of his head and soon after collapsed to the ground unconscious. At 3:30 PM that day, doctors announced his death due to a massive cerebral hemorrhage in the brain.

Auschwitz was the biggest concentration camp in WWII. On this day Soviet troops entered the camp and it was liberated . The surviving prisoners were set free.
